The Community Director generally has a broader leadership role, overseeing multiple community programs and strategic initiatives. In contrast, a Community Manager focuses more on day-to-day operations and direct engagement with residents or members. Both roles require similar credentials and are used across various sectors, but the Community Director typically operates at a higher strategic level.
What Does a Community Director Do?
A community director is involved in managing business processes and overseeing property for a community of homes or an apartment complex. Their duties are to supervise relations with residents, manage maintenance services, and inspect the property regularly. They also meet potential residents to show them the community, set occupancy targets, and create strategies to meet those targets. A community director may work with third-party service providers to ensure that residents have access to necessary services. Qualifications to become a community director vary, but may include a degree or job experience in real estate or property management.

Job description
TITLE: Community Schools Site Director
SALARY: $18.87 per hour
BENEFITS: Full benefits including paid holidays, sick leave, annual leave, holiday pay, health insurance and retirement. Local supplement of 5.5% starts the month after completion of first year.
QUALIFICATIONS:
1. Bachelor's Degree in Child Development, Elementary Education or related field
2. One year administrative experience preferred
3. One year experience managing and supervising a licensed after-school program or child care
4. CPR, Standard First Aid and Playground Safety certification highly desirable
5. Such alternatives or additional qualifications as Board of Education finds appropriate and acceptable
REPORTS TO: Director, Community Schools
SUPERVISES: Assistant Site Directors, Group Leaders, Substitutes, Volunteers
PERSONNEL REQUIREMENTS:
PERFORMANCE RESPOSIBILITIES:
1. Program Responsibilities
a. Plans, organizes and supervises all program activities in accordance with the NC Child Care Licensing Requirements.
b. Assures adherence to policies relating to the operation of After-School and Summer Camp programs in this school system.
c. Provides an environment that insures the safety and well being of students and staff.
d. Provides an environment that meets and accommodates the individual mental, physical, emotional and social developmental needs of students.
e. Provides age-appropriate materials to support daily activity plans.
f. Plans, directs and evaluates full-day school-age care program on all Teacher Workdays.
g. Plans and implements field trips for students.
h. Solicits, assesses and implements student, parent and staff ideas for program activities.
i. Utilizes school, program and community resources to enhance program goals and provide enriching activities for students.
j. Compiles and distributes four site newsletters annually.
k. Assists Program Supervisor with updating and developing program theme packets.
2. Administrative Responsibilities
a. Directs the After-School and Summer Camp sites in accordance with school rules.
b. Ensures the implementation of age-appropriate, creative and engaging daily activities that foster a positive environment for students in grades K-5.
c. Supervises Assistant Site Directors, Group Leaders, volunteers and substitutes.
d. Provides positive, professional role modeling in teaching and directing.
e. Prepares and posts daily activity plans in accordance with NC Licensing requirements.
f. Assists in the selection and training of Assistant Site Directors, Group Leaders and substitutes.
g. Counsels staff as needed to ensure program continuity.
h. Follows school district and program policies for managing student behavior.
i. Monitors and approves staff time sheets.
j. Attends Site Director meetings and holds weekly staff meetings.
k. Monitors program daily and evaluates program effectiveness.
l. Evaluates staff performance according to district policy.
m. Maintains district health and safety guidelines in accordance with OSHA standards.
n. Adheres to National School Lunch regulations for student snacks and lunches.
o. Develops and follows appropriate procedures for emergency situations.
p. Cooperates, collaborates and communicates frequently with the school administrators and teachers to provide effective programming and to build strong relationships with school personnel.
q. Organizes and directs site-based After-School Advisory Committee.
r. Utilizes financial resources efficiently, monitors expenses and maintains accurate records.
s. Reports building, equipment repairs to the Principal and Director of Community Schools.
t. Conducts monthly fire drills and other drills as required; maintains records of drills.
u. Maintains daily student attendance, medical and emergency records.
v. Performs other duties as assigned by the Director of Community Schools.
T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T:
After-School Program: Ten months, full-time, hours determined by program requirements.
EVALUATION: Performance is evaluated annually in accordance with the Board of Education's policy on Evaluation of Classified Personnel.
